EPEL Minor Version End of Life
Description
Each minor release of EPEL is maintained as laid out in the EPEL policy.
At the conclusion of the maintenance period, an EPEL release enters "End of Life" status, also known as retirement. This procedure describes the tasks necessary to move a release to that status.
Preparatory steps
Send announcement
Before the actual retirement takes place, send a reminder to the epel-devel@ list that it will be happening soon. You can use this email as a reference.
|
We’re not able to declare a specific date for the retirement because it is dependent on the RHEL schedule. As a rough guideline, try to send the reminder announcement at the beginning of the month in which the next RHEL minor version is expected to occur. |
Prepare ansible changes
Some of the EOL process is controlled by ansible playbooks. Before these are run some changes will be needed in the ansible repo. Set these up ahead of time in a pull request, which will be merged on EOL day. These changes should include:

You can use this pull request as a reference.
RHEL buildroot pre-seeding
To speed up the sync of RHEL infra repos, pre-seed the RHEL 10.2 directory on batcave01 by copying the 10.1 directory.
$ cd /mnt/fedora/app/fi-repo/rhel/rhel{epel_major}
$ mkdir {epel_major}.{epel_z_minor}
$ rsync -avH --link-dest=$PWD/{epel_major}.{epel_eol_minor}/repos {epel_major}.{epel_eol_minor}/repos/ {epel_major}.{epel_z_minor}/repos/
EOL day
Send announcement
Reply to the previous announcement to state that the mass branching is starting. Also send the corresponding mail archive link to the #epel:fedoraproject.org matrix channel.
Koji tasks
Disable builds by removing targets.
$ koji remove-target epel{epel_major}.{epel_eol_minor}
$ koji remove-target epel{epel_major}.{epel_eol_minor}-candidate
Remove any existing sidetags from the EOL release.
$ koji remove-sidetag $(koji list-sidetags --basetag epel{epel_major}.{epel_eol_minor}-build)
This must be done with koji remove-sidetag and not koji remove-target because just removing the target of a sidetag will leave it in a weird state where it cannot be removed.
Final stable push
Do a final stable push for the EPEL-10.1 release in Bodhi, following the Pushing Updates SOP.
Bodhi tasks
Run the following bodhi commands to set the EPEL-10.1 release to the archived state.
$ bodhi releases edit --name EPEL-{epel_major}.{epel_eol_minor} --state archived
Run the playbooks
Run the following playbooks to apply the changes made in ansible.
$ sudo rbac-playbook groups/batcave.yml $ sudo rbac-playbook groups/bodhi-backend.yml $ sudo rbac-playbook groups/koji-hub.yml $ sudo rbac-playbook -t all,rollout openshift-apps/bodhi.yml
You will need to have someone enable sshd on autosign02 and then run:
$ sudo rbac-playbook manual/autosign.yml
And then someone with the robosignatory passphrase will need to restart it.
Manually sync RHEL repos
Normally RHEL repos are synced via a cron job, but run them manually the first time to ensure completion. Run the sync script on batcave01:
$ sudo /mnt/fedora/app/fi-repo/rhel/rhel{epel_major}/rhel{epel_major}-sync
Koji tasks again
Remove the CentOS snapshot external repos.
$ koji remove-external-repo c{epel_major}-snapshot-baseos epel{epel_major}.{epel_z_minor}-base
$ koji remove-external-repo c{epel_major}-snapshot-appstream epel{epel_major}.{epel_z_minor}-base
$ koji remove-external-repo c{epel_major}-snapshot-crb epel{epel_major}.{epel_z_minor}-base
Add the RHEL 10.2 external repos.
$ koji add-external-repo \
--mode bare \
--priority 10 \
--tag epel{epel_major}.{epel_z_minor}-base \
rhel{epel_major}.{epel_z_minor}-baseos \
'https://infrastructure.fedoraproject.org/repo/rhel/rhel{epel_major}/{epel_major}.{epel_z_minor}/repos/$arch/baseos/'
$ koji add-external-repo \
--mode bare \
--priority 20 \
--tag epel{epel_major}.{epel_z_minor}-base \
rhel{epel_major}.{epel_z_minor}-appstream \
'https://infrastructure.fedoraproject.org/repo/rhel/rhel{epel_major}/{epel_major}.{epel_z_minor}/repos/$arch/appstream/'
$ koji add-external-repo \
--mode bare \
--priority 30 \
--tag epel{epel_major}.{epel_z_minor}-base \
rhel{epel_major}.{epel_z_minor}-crb \
'https://infrastructure.fedoraproject.org/repo/rhel/rhel{epel_major}/{epel_major}.{epel_z_minor}/repos/$arch/crb/'
Move epel10z floating tag to next minor version.
$ koji remove-tag-inheritance epel{epel_major}z epel{epel_major}.{epel_eol_minor}
$ koji add-tag-inheritance epel{epel_major}z epel{epel_major}.{epel_z_minor}
Move epel10-infra floating tag to next minor version.
$ koji remove-tag-inheritance epel{epel_major}-infra epel{epel_major}.{epel_eol_minor}-build
$ koji add-tag-inheritance epel{epel_major}-infra epel{epel_major}.{epel_z_minor}-build
Mirror tasks
Log into the MirrorManager Admin Panel and reconfigure the repository redirects as follows.
-
epel-z-10 → epel-z-10.2
-
epel-z-debug-10 → epel-z-debug-10.2
-
epel-z-source-10 → epel-z-source-10.2
-
epel-z-testing-10 → epel-z-testing-10.2
-
epel-z-testing-debug-10 → epel-z-testing-debug-10.2
-
epel-z-testing-source-10 → epel-z-testing-source-10.2
Run the following commands on batcave01 to switch symlinks on the mirrors.
$ sudo ln -sfn {epel_major}.{epel_z_minor} /pub/epel/{epel_major}z
$ sudo ln -sfn {epel_major}.{epel_z_minor} /pub/epel/testing/{epel_major}z
Koschei
Remove the EPEL 10.1 collection in koschei.
To be able do this, you will first need to log into os-control01 and run the following commands to get into the console.
$ oc project koschei $ oc rsh deploy/admin
After that, you will be able to delete the EPEL 10.1 collection using the koschei-admin tool.
$ koschei-admin delete-collection --force epel{epel_major}.{epel_eol_minor}
Send announcement
Announce the completion of the retirement. Post this to Fedora Discussion in the Project Discussion category with the #epel-sig tag. Also send an email to the epel-devel@ and devel@ lists.
Consider Before Running
-
Resource contention in infrastructure, such as outages
-
Extenuating circumstances for specific planned updates, if any
-
Send the reminder announcement, if it isn’t sent already
